**Exploring the Dach Region: A Review of Books and Documentaries**

The DACH region, consisting of Germany (D), Austria (A), and Switzerland (CH), is known for its breathtaking landscapes, rich history, and vibrant culture. Whether you're planning a trip to these countries or simply want to learn more about them from the comfort of your home, books and documentaries can offer valuable insights. In this post, we'll delve into some recommendations for books and documentaries that provide a fascinating look into the DACH region. **Books** 1. *The Year of the Hare* by Arto Paasilinna (Finland) - While not set in the DACH region itself, this novel tells the humorous and heartwarming story of a man's journey through the Finnish wilderness with a wild hare. It offers a glimpse into the natural beauty and charm of the Nordic countries. 2. *A Whole Life* by Robert Seethaler (Austria) - Set in the Austrian Alps, this novel follows the life of a man named Andreas Egger as he navigates the challenges and joys of mountain living. The book beautifully captures the rugged landscapes and resilient spirit of rural Austria. 3. *Swiss Watching: Inside the Land of Milk and Money* by Diccon Bewes (Switzerland) - Delving into the quirks and nuances of Swiss society, this book offers an entertaining and informative look at what makes Switzerland unique. From its political system to its chocolate consumption, Bewes provides a colorful portrait of the country. **Documentaries** 1. *More Than Honey* (Switzerland) - This visually stunning documentary explores the world of bees and the vital role they play in our ecosystem. Filmed in Switzerland and other parts of the world, it sheds light on the threats facing these essential pollinators and the impact on agriculture. 2. *Sound of Music: The Documentary* (Austria) - Fans of the classic film "The Sound of Music" will enjoy this behind-the-scenes documentary that delves into the making of the movie in the picturesque Austrian Alps. Learn about the real von Trapp family and the film's enduring legacy. 3. *Germany: Memories of a Nation* (Germany) - In this documentary series, British art historian Neil MacGregor explores the history of Germany through objects and artifacts. From the Brandenburg Gate to the Berlin Wall, MacGregor provides a comprehensive and engaging look at the country's complex past. Whether you're an armchair traveler or planning your next adventure in the DACH region, these books and documentaries offer a window into the rich tapestry of culture, history, and natural beauty that these countries have to offer.
